Safety downloading system for application program
An application and application installation technology, applied in transmission systems, electrical components, software deployment, etc., can solve the problems of script decryption and permission checking, time-consuming, poor user experience, and complexity.
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0090] figure 1It shows a schematic structural diagram of a secure application download system provided in this embodiment. It can be seen from the figure that the system includes a security module provider SEI background server 120, an application provider SP background server 130, and a security The security module SE 111 provided by the module provider SEI; the SEI background server 120 is connected to the SP background server 130 through a network.
[0091] In this embodiment, the SP background server 130 includes an SP application installation file generating means 131 , an operation request sending means 132 , an APP generating means 133 and an APP issuing means 134 . The SEI background server 120 includes an SEI key generation device 122 , an SEI key management device 123 and an SEI encryption device 124 .
[0092] The SP application installation file generation device 131 is used to generate the application installation file of the application; the operation request s...
Embodiment 2
[0107] figure 2 It shows a schematic structural diagram of a secure application program downloading system provided in this embodiment. On the basis of Embodiment 1, the system further includes a mobile terminal device 110 with the security module SE111 securely. The SEI decryption key SK.SEI.SEC generated by the SEI background server 120 is loaded in the module SE 111 . in:
[0108] The mobile terminal device is configured to download from the application download platform a downloadable application program APP installation package corresponding to the supplier information of the security module SE installed in the mobile terminal device, and analyze the downloaded APP installation package , get the ciphertext of the application installation file;
[0109] The security module SE is used to decrypt the ciphertext of the application installation file by using the stored SEI decryption key SK.SEI.SEC to obtain the application installation file P, and execute the application i...
Embodiment 3
[0120] image 3 It shows a schematic structural diagram of a secure application download system provided in this embodiment. On the basis of Embodiment 1 or Embodiment 2 in this embodiment, the SP background server 130 sends the SEI background server 120 to the The application operation request also includes a personalization request for satisfying the personalized processing of the application provided by the application provider SP. Correspondingly, in the secure download system described in this embodiment, on the basis of Embodiment 1, the SEI background server 120 further includes a personalized request response script generator 121 .
[0121] The personalization request response script generator 121 is configured to generate a personalization request response script SE.SCRIPT.PERSON that satisfies the personalization request when the received application operation request includes the personalization request;
[0122] At this point, the SEI background server 120 sends t...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com